How long does driveway paving take in Coveville?

Most residential driveway projects in Coveville take 2-3 days from start to finish, depending on size and drainage requirements. Day one typically involves excavation and site preparation, including any necessary drainage work.

Day two focuses on base preparation and initial paving, while day three handles finishing work and final compaction. Weather can affect timing, especially during spring when ground conditions vary, but we provide realistic timelines upfront and keep you updated if anything changes.

Complex drainage issues or larger commercial projects may require additional time, but we discuss those specifics during the initial site assessment so there are no surprises.

Coveville properties deal with unique challenges due to varied soil composition throughout the area. Clay soils hold water and can cause heaving and settling issues, while sandy areas may drain too quickly and undermine the driveway base.

We start every project by figuring out where water comes from and where it needs to go. Sometimes that means creating swales or drainage channels, other times we adjust slopes to direct water away from structures. For serious drainage issues, we may recommend installing drainage tile or catch basins as part of the paving work.

The key is solving the problem permanently rather than just moving water to a different part of your property. Our 25+ years of local experience means we know what works and what doesn’t in Coveville’s specific conditions.

Driveway paving costs in Coveville typically range from $2,400 to $4,800 for a standard 600 square foot residential driveway, depending on site conditions and drainage requirements. Properties with complex drainage issues or challenging access may require additional investment.

We provide transparent, upfront pricing that includes all site preparation, materials, and labor – no hidden fees or surprise charges. The owner personally evaluates every project and discusses options that fit your budget and timeline.

Factors affecting cost include existing drainage conditions, soil type, access for equipment, and any necessary excavation work. We explain exactly what your project requires during the initial consultation so you can make an informed decision.

Asphalt driveways cost less upfront and handle freeze-thaw cycles better than concrete in Coveville’s climate. They’re also easier to repair if damage occurs and can be sealcoated to extend their lifespan significantly.

Concrete lasts longer overall but costs more initially and can crack during harsh winters if not properly installed with adequate drainage. Repairs are also more complex and expensive than asphalt maintenance.

For Coveville properties, asphalt typically makes more sense due to our weather patterns and soil conditions. It provides reliable performance at a reasonable cost, and maintenance is straightforward when needed. Proper maintenance starts with keeping water moving away from the driveway surface. Clean debris from drainage areas regularly, especially after storms, and address any standing water issues immediately before they cause damage.

Sealcoating every 2-3 years protects the asphalt from weather and extends its lifespan significantly. We recommend this especially for Coveville driveways due to our freeze-thaw cycles and temperature extremes throughout the year.

Minor cracks should be filled promptly to prevent water infiltration and further damage.
